NodeRed-Tutorial Part 6: Integration von Philips Hue

แชร์
ฝัง
  • เผยแพร่เมื่อ 14 ก.พ. 2018
  • ⬇ ⬇ Alle Befehle und weitere Informationen im Blog-Beitrag weiter unten in der Infobox ⬇ ⬇
    ➤ 👨‍🎓 Node-RED-Master-Kurs: haus-automatisierung.com/node...
    ➤ Blog-Beitrag: haus-automatisierung.com/node...
    ▬ Mehr zum Thema ▬▬▬▬▬▬▬
    Tutorials / Online-Kurse:
    👨‍🎓 haus-automatisierung.com/kurse/
    Podcast (Draht zu smart):
    🔈 haus-automatisierung.com/podc...
    Newsletter:
    ✉️ haus-automatisierung.com/news...
    Zweitkanal:
    🎬 / @kleineszuhause
    ▬ Social Media ▬▬▬▬▬▬▬
    Instagram: / haus_automation
    Facebook: / hausautomatisierungcom
    LinkedIn: / hausautomatisierungcom
    Patreon: / haus_automation
    GitHub: github.com/klein0r
    #smarthome #homeautomation #nodered
  • วิทยาศาสตร์และเทคโนโลยี

ความคิดเห็น • 48

  • @haus_automation
    @haus_automation  5 ปีที่แล้ว

    Umfangreicher Node-Red-Kurs:
    ➤ shop.haus-automatisierung.com/nodered-grundlagen-kurs.html

  • @ChristophGranz
    @ChristophGranz 3 ปีที่แล้ว

    Toll erklärt! Ich habe heute angefangen, mich mit Node Red zu beschäftigen. Deine Erklärungen helfen echt weiter.

  • @michaelgorges2638
    @michaelgorges2638 3 ปีที่แล้ว +1

    Super Video. Als Anfänger sehr guter Einstieg. Versuche gerade Hue mit KNX zu kombinieren und das mit Hilfe von Node Red, bin sehr begeistert.

  • @MarcoNeumann-MD-
    @MarcoNeumann-MD- 6 ปีที่แล้ว +1

    Top Video!
    Habe NodeRed auch im Einsatz und mir gefällt das Teil immer mehr.
    Bitte mach weiter so!

  • @Bytec1977
    @Bytec1977 6 ปีที่แล้ว +3

    Danke für Deine Videos insgesamt aber vor allem auch über Node-Red.
    Ich bin absolut begeistert von diesem System und denke es sehr viel Potential hat.
    Ich habe auch schon einiges damit bei mir gemacht. Wo ich manchmal noch auf dem Schlauch stehe sind diese "Functions" um irgendwelche Werte zu extrahieren. Da hat mir das Video heute aber schon wieder ein wenig die Augen geöffnet.
    Nochmal vielen Dank und mach weiter so auch gerne mehr Videos über Node Red.

    • @haus_automation
      @haus_automation  6 ปีที่แล้ว

      Ja man muss immer überlegen was man reinbekommt und was man raus haben möchte. Ist teilweise etwas debugging nötig. Freut mich, wenn ich Dir helfen konnte :)

  • @christophermende4921
    @christophermende4921 6 ปีที่แล้ว +2

    Perfekt - auch gut ein bischen mein Deutsch zu üben. :)

  • @ReaperJamSessions
    @ReaperJamSessions 5 ปีที่แล้ว +1

    Great Video I have now started my own home automation system

  • @dimitridaelman
    @dimitridaelman 4 ปีที่แล้ว +1

    This saved me from going insane, thx a lot!!

  • @StefanHanke
    @StefanHanke 6 ปีที่แล้ว +2

    ...vielen Dank für diese NodeRed-Reihe. Einen kleinen Einblick habe ich dadurch auf alle Fälle schon mal erhalten. Was mich interessieren würde, wie kann man das unter iOBroker verwenden. Ein Dashboard benötige ich hier nicht, da ich in VIS visualisiere. Wie kann ich die Werte nutzen, z.B. in Variablen schreiben um sie dann in iOBroker in Scripten oder zur Visualisierung zu nutzen. Konkret geht es bei mir um den NEST Protect, den Rauchmelder. Hierzu gibt es wohl eine Verbindung über NodeRed. Mir ist allerdings der Weg noch nicht ganz klar Geplante Anwendungen sind Status-Darstellung in VIS und z.B. "wenn Alarm dann alle Lichter an". Mir würde deshalb ein Video von Dir zum Thema NodeRed und iOBroker sehr helfen, wenn ich einmal den Weg sehe, kann ich den bestimmt an meine Anwendung anpassen.
    Vielleicht klappt das ja, schon mal vielen Dank im voraus...
    VG
    Stefan

  • @rafaeljodl2048
    @rafaeljodl2048 4 ปีที่แล้ว

    Hallo, und vielen dank vorab für die Super Videos. Habe bei mir ein kleines Problem gefunden... zwar Funktioniert alles so wie in deinem Video beschrieben... jedoch ist mir aufgefallen dass auch bei dir (Minute 18:29) viele Fehlermeldungen zurück kommen sobald man an dem Slider etwas verändert. Idee wieso das so ist und was man dagegen machen kann?

  • @tihe2523
    @tihe2523 6 ปีที่แล้ว +1

    HI tolles Video! Kannst du mal erklären wie man den Hue Motion als trigger einbindet.

    • @haus_automation
      @haus_automation  6 ปีที่แล้ว

      Habe leider keine hue motion

    • @ptrsteiner
      @ptrsteiner 3 ปีที่แล้ว

      Top Videos... Was ich leider nirgends finde, wie man aus zwei Nodes in eine Funcrion Node - Daten übergeben kann (msg)... Könnt ihr da mal ein Beispiel machen?

  • @franciscodavidgonzalezespi4639
    @franciscodavidgonzalezespi4639 4 ปีที่แล้ว +1

    awesome videos, do you know if there is any way to create an ambiligth by connecting to the hue bridge from a raspberry and using an external hdmi video source and capture the signal with a usb video grabber and the hue lights take that signal to sync? Cheers

  • @TheSchumiie
    @TheSchumiie 5 ปีที่แล้ว

    Moin , ändert sich bei euch auch die Farbe wieder selbstständig ? Also ich stelle eine farbe ein und sie stellt sich jedes mal wieder um , kennst du dazu eine Lösung ?

  • @marcussterner8504
    @marcussterner8504 4 ปีที่แล้ว

    I can´t find how i do if I wan´t to turn off a scene. And can´t find anything about this anywhere. Someone?

  • @XGodnessHimselfX
    @XGodnessHimselfX ปีที่แล้ว

    Hallo, ich möchte die Hue Produkte Via zigbee2mqtt anlernen und via Node Red nutzen. Kannst du evtl. hierfür auch einmal ein Video machen oder mir ein paar tipps geben, wie ich das hinbekomme?

  • @jochenweber492
    @jochenweber492 ปีที่แล้ว

    Danke, Matthias. Deine Videos und Kurse haben mir schon oft weitergeholfen! Seit dem Update auf node-red-contrib-huemagic 4.2.2 funktioniert nichts mehr. Beim Suchen von Sensoren, etc. kommt immer die Fehlermeldung "Etwas ist schief gelaufen. Bitte versuchen Sie es erneut." Hat schon jemand eine Lösung?

    • @jan6800
      @jan6800 ปีที่แล้ว

      Hallo Jochen, Ich habe ganz genau das gleiche Problem!!!
      Ich bin auch auf der Suche nach einer Lösung, aber habe nichts gefunden!
      Hast du vielleicht in der Zwischenzeit eine Lösung gefunden?

  • @gungran
    @gungran 5 ปีที่แล้ว

    Hallo, ich habe deine Anleitung bei mir fast 1:1 umgesetzt. Allerdings erhalte ich bei der Hue Light vor der function wo brightness, color etc. extrahiert werden immer einen connection error. Das Debug spuckt Error: Huejay: read ECONNRESET und Error: Huejay: socket hang up aus.. Irgendeinen Tip für mich? ^^ Vielen Dank!

  • @bluenazgul1982
    @bluenazgul1982 4 ปีที่แล้ว

    Ich bekomme es leider nicht hin, einen "Slider" für die Helligkeit einzubinden, es scheitert an den passenden Funktionen zum auslesen und einlesen der Helligkeit bzw der korrekten Formatierung

  • @gnomiberlin1341
    @gnomiberlin1341 2 ปีที่แล้ว

    Hallo Matthias,
    würdest Du heute noch node-red-contrib-huemagic zum Anbinden der Hue-Bridge an Kode-Red verwenden? Ich möchte nicht den privaten Einsatz von Tools für die freie Verwendung schälern, aber ich finde es sind viele Bugs enthalten. Vor allem die falschen Stati nach Ereignissen in "lastState" und die oft Unmassen von Nachrichten nach einer Statusänderung. Ich weiß nicht ob es an der Hue-Bridge oder dieser SW liegt, aber nach einer Anpassung einer Lampe (helligkeit, Farbe,...) kommen 3-10 Events mit gleichem Inhalt nach einer individuellen Einstellungsänderung, wobei auch noch manche Events anscheinend in der Flut verloren gehen. Es gibt dort auch offene Github-Bugs in dieser Richtung.
    Gibt es heute bessere Node-Red Implementierungen?

  • @hamsibaba61
    @hamsibaba61 3 ปีที่แล้ว

    Hi, wie kann ich eine Außen-Steckdose die ich über die HUE angemeldet habe ich Homekit anzeigen lassen? Redmatic ist installiert auf Rasperrymatic. dieses Plagin habe ich auch installiert. wie verbinde ich beides? so das in der Redmatic Homematic Liste diese Steckdose mit gelistet ist? Danke Vorab.

  • @RobertBaranovski
    @RobertBaranovski 6 ปีที่แล้ว +2

    Also die Funktion color-Picker will part nicht funktionieren
    Egal welche Farbe ich wähle, die Lampe schaltet immer auf Blau :/

    • @haus_automation
      @haus_automation  6 ปีที่แล้ว

      Habe ich mit der letzten Version auch. Habe dazu einen issue angelegt. Eventuell kannst du mich da ja noch unterstützen 😉 der Autor meint es ist alles richtig

  • @marvinthiel1669
    @marvinthiel1669 4 ปีที่แล้ว +1

    Guten Abend, bin neu in Node Red und ich würde mich für dein Dashboard Theme interessieren. Wäre es möglich das zu bekommen?

  • @sebastianhegener782
    @sebastianhegener782 5 ปีที่แล้ว +1

    läuft dieses paket nicht mehr? ich würd gern meinen motion sensor einbinden aber finde nur diesen weg und der scheint nicht mehr zu funktionieren-.-

    • @haus_automation
      @haus_automation  5 ปีที่แล้ว

      Doch bei mir klappt alles einwandfrei

    • @sebastianhegener782
      @sebastianhegener782 5 ปีที่แล้ว

      interresant ist das mir in meinem node red dieses paket nicht angezeigt wird. bin aber auch noch neuling mit io broker! wenn ich das paket im browser suche dann den (npm) befehl kopiere und unter instanzen auf node red versuche das einzubinden bekomme ein error! und wie gesagt im node red selber wird mir hue magic gar nicht angezeigt. hab auch schon eine ältere node red version ausprobiert
      Danke schonmal für die antwort;)

  • @kaztraz
    @kaztraz 2 ปีที่แล้ว

    I need this in english... :D

  • @TobiTheHood
    @TobiTheHood ปีที่แล้ว +1

    Gibt es eigentlich auch eine Möglichkeit eine Hue Lampe wieder auf einen KNX Taster zu legen?

  • @Eulhofer
    @Eulhofer 3 ปีที่แล้ว +1

    Hallo Matthias,
    also irgendwie finde ich die Befehle/weiteren Informationen:
    "⬇ ⬇ Alle Befehle und weitere Informationen im Blog-Beitrag weiter unten in der Infobox ⬇ ⬇"
    nicht... ist doch der Link:
    "➤ Blog-Beitrag: @t",
    oder?
    Viele Grüße,
    Wolfgang

    • @haus_automation
      @haus_automation  3 ปีที่แล้ว

      Ja genau, was fehlt dir denn konkret?

    • @Eulhofer
      @Eulhofer 3 ปีที่แล้ว +1

      Ich habe mir das nochmal langsam angeschaut und erkennen können, wie Du dem "function-node" mehrere Ausgänge "verpasst". Ich hatte das mal woanders irgendwie anders gesehen...
      So in der Art: msg.payload (ausgang1, ausgang2, ausgang3) - also kommasepariert (oder Semikolon?) in irgendwelchen Klammern (rund, geschweift, eckig) - finde das aber nicht mehr.
      Ist das gleichwertig mit Deiner Vorgehensweise, oder nimmt man bei bestimmten Aufgaben die eine, bzw. die andere Art?
      Viele Grüße, Wolfgang

    • @haus_automation
      @haus_automation  3 ปีที่แล้ว

      @@Eulhofer Du musst ein Array zurückgeben. Also eckige Klammern. payload ist keine Funktion :)

    • @Eulhofer
      @Eulhofer 3 ปีที่แล้ว +1

      Stimmt... Mit eckigen Klammern...
      Ich habs gefunden...
      ... return [msg.hour, msg.minute, msg.second]; ....
      So wurden die drei Ausgänge "beschickt".... (aus einer großen Sekundenzahl wurden die resultierenden Stunden, Minuten und verbleibenden Sekunden errechnet)

  • @tschu_tschuu
    @tschu_tschuu 4 ปีที่แล้ว +1

    Hallo
    Hab hier ein Problem und vielleicht kannst du mir da helfen:
    Hab da etwas Ähnliches mit node red gebaut(möchte über einen KNX TAster die Hue Lampen Dimmen) aber wenn ich die Brightness an den Hue Baustein übergeben will bekomme ich immer einen Input Error. Das Dimmen funktioniert zwar problemlos an der Lampe, aber das debug window ist voll mit Fehlern:
    msg : error
    "Error: Philips Hue: 7, invalid value, null}, for parameter, transitiontime"
    Hab die brightness gleich wie du mit der funktion als Objekt übergeben:
    return { payload: { brightness: msg.payload} };
    Habs auch schon mal mit einer einfachen injection versucht, einen fixen Brightnesswert an den Hue Baustein zu übergeben, aber da kommt der selbe Error.

    • @haus_automation
      @haus_automation  4 ปีที่แล้ว +1

      Dann gib doch in einer zweiten Eigenschaft die Transitiontime mit, wenn er die unbedingt haben möchte ;)

    • @tschu_tschuu
      @tschu_tschuu 4 ปีที่แล้ว +1

      @@haus_automation Das hab ich auch schon probiert, aber mit:
      return [ { payload: { brightness: msg.payload} },
      {payload: { transitionTime: 1} }
      ];
      kommt der gleiche Fehler. Vielleicht übergebe ich das falsch? komm da nicht ganz dahinter.
      Grüße

    • @haus_automation
      @haus_automation  4 ปีที่แล้ว

      @@tschu_tschuu Was Du gebaut hast, ist ein Array mit 2 Payloads. Was Du brauchst ist ein Objekt mit zwei Eigenschaften:
      msg.payload = {
      brightness: msg.payload,
      transitionTime: 1
      };
      return msg;

    • @haus_automation
      @haus_automation  4 ปีที่แล้ว +1

      Ich nehme an, Du bist nicht im NodeRed-Kurs angemeldet? :) Da ist alles erklärt.

    • @tschu_tschuu
      @tschu_tschuu 4 ปีที่แล้ว

      @@haus_automation noch nicht, muss ich mir mal anschauen :D